Subject: [PATCH 10/18] drm/i915: Introduce a global_seqno for each request
Date: Wed, 14 Sep 2016 07:52:42 +0100	[thread overview]
Message-ID: <20160914065250.15482-11-chris@chris-wilson.co.uk> (raw)
In-Reply-To: <20160914065250.15482-1-chris@chris-wilson.co.uk>

Though we will have multiple timelines, we still have a single timeline
of execution. This we can use to provide an execution and retirement order
of requests. This keeps tracking execution of requests simple, and vital
for preserving a single waiter (i.e. so that we can order the waiters so
that only the earliest to wakeup need be woken). To accomplish this we
distinguish the seqno used to order requests per-context (external) and
that used internally for execution.

diff --git a/drivers/gpu/drm/i915/i915_gem_request.h b/drivers/gpu/drm/i915/i915_gem_request.h
index 6c78ca0d85a9..22dd7ac270e6 100644
--- a/drivers/gpu/drm/i915/i915_gem_request.h
+++ b/drivers/gpu/drm/i915/i915_gem_request.h
@@ -87,6 +87,8 @@ struct drm_i915_gem_request {
 	struct i915_sw_fence submit;
 	wait_queue_t submitq;
 
+	u32 global_seqno;
+
 	/** GEM sequence number associated with the previous request,
 	 * when the HWS breadcrumb is equal to this the GPU is processing
 	 * this request.
@@ -163,7 +165,7 @@ void i915_gem_request_retire_upto(struct drm_i915_gem_request *req);
 static inline u32
 i915_gem_request_get_seqno(struct drm_i915_gem_request *req)
 {
-	return req ? req->fence.seqno : 0;
+	return req ? req->global_seqno : 0;
 }
 
 static inline struct intel_engine_cs *
@@ -248,17 +250,35 @@ static inline bool i915_seqno_passed(u32 seq1, u32 seq2)
 }
 
 static inline bool
-i915_gem_request_started(const struct drm_i915_gem_request *req)
+__i915_gem_request_started(const struct drm_i915_gem_request *req)
 {
 	return i915_seqno_passed(intel_engine_get_seqno(req->engine),
 				 req->previous_seqno);
 }
 
 static inline bool
-i915_gem_request_completed(const struct drm_i915_gem_request *req)
+i915_gem_request_started(const struct drm_i915_gem_request *req)
+{
+	if (!req->global_seqno)
+		return false;
+
+	return __i915_gem_request_started(req);
+}
+
+static inline bool
+__i915_gem_request_completed(const struct drm_i915_gem_request *req)
 {
 	return i915_seqno_passed(intel_engine_get_seqno(req->engine),
-				 req->fence.seqno);
+				 req->global_seqno);
+}
+
+static inline bool
+i915_gem_request_completed(const struct drm_i915_gem_request *req)
+{
+	if (!req->global_seqno)
+		return false;
+
+	return __i915_gem_request_completed(req);
 }
 
 bool __i915_spin_request(const struct drm_i915_gem_request *request,
@@ -266,7 +286,7 @@ bool __i915_spin_request(const struct drm_i915_gem_request *request,
 static inline bool i915_spin_request(const struct drm_i915_gem_request *request,
 				     int state, unsigned long timeout_us)
 {
-	return (i915_gem_request_started(request) &&
+	return (__i915_gem_request_started(request) &&
 		__i915_spin_request(request, state, timeout_us));
 }
